隨著云計算技術的快速發展,云服務器掛機程序越來越受到人們的關注和需求。云服務器掛機程序是指利用云服務器來運行持續性的任務或程序,例如數據分析、模擬仿真、機器學習等。它們通常需要長時間的運行,并且可以通過遠程訪問來實現管理和控制。那么,云服務器掛機程序需要什么基礎呢?本文將從硬件、操作系統、網絡和編程等方面進行探討。
一、硬件基礎:
云服務器掛機程序中的硬件基礎主要包括計算機服務器、CPU、內存和存儲設備。
1. 計算機服務器:云服務器掛機程序需要一個強大的計算機服務器來處理大量的計算任務。服務器的配置和性能直接影響到程序的運行效果和速度。
2. CPU:CPU是云服務器掛機程序的核心,它負責執行程序中的指令和計算任務。因此,選擇一款高性能、多核心的CPU是非常重要的。
3. 內存:云服務器掛機程序通常需要大量的內存來存儲數據和運行程序。因此,選擇內存容量足夠大的服務器是必要的。
4. 存儲設備:云服務器掛機程序需要一個穩定的存儲設備來存儲程序和數據。快速的固態硬盤(SSD)是一個不錯的選擇,因為它可以提供更好的讀寫性能。
二、操作系統基礎:
云服務器掛機程序需要一個穩定、安全的操作系統來運行和管理。目前,常見的操作系統包括Linux和Windows。
1. Linux操作系統:Linux是一種開源的操作系統,具有高度的穩定性、靈活性和安全性。它支持多種編程語言和工具,并且有強大的命令行和腳本能力,非常適合運行云服務器掛機程序。
2. Windows操作系統:Windows也是一種常用的操作系統,它具有用戶友好的界面和廣泛的支持。雖然Windows在一些方面不如Linux,但它也可以作為云服務器掛機程序的運行環境。
三、網絡基礎:
云服務器掛機程序需要一個穩定、高速的網絡環境來傳輸數據和進行遠程管理。
1. 網絡帶寬:云服務器掛機程序通常需要大量的帶寬來傳輸數據和與遠程管理系統進行通信。因此,選擇帶寬足夠大的服務器和網絡供應商是非常重要的。
2. 網絡延遲:云服務器掛機程序對網絡延遲也有一定要求,特別是對于實時的任務或程序。因此,選擇網絡延遲較低的服務器和網絡供應商也是需要考慮的。
四、編程基礎:
云服務器掛機程序需要一定的編程基礎來編寫和調試程序。下面列舉一些常見的編程語言和工具。
1. Python:Python是一種易于學習和使用的編程語言,廣泛用于科學計算、數據分析和人工智能等領域。它擁有豐富的第三方庫和工具,可以方便地編寫云服務器掛機程序。
2. Java:Java是一種跨平臺的編程語言,具有強大的性能和廣泛的應用。它可以運行在不同的操作系統和硬件平臺上,適合編寫大規模的云服務器掛機程序。
3. C/C :C/C 是一種底層的編程語言,對計算機硬件的控制能力強。雖然它相對復雜一些,但可以編寫高效的云服務器掛機程序。
5. 編程工具:除了編程語言,還需要一些編程工具和環境來輔助開發和調試云服務器掛機程序。例如集成開發環境(IDE)、調試器和版本控制工具等。
結論:
云服務器掛機程序需要一定的硬件基礎、操作系統基礎、網絡基礎和編程基礎來運行和管理。選擇適合的計算機服務器、操作系統、網絡環境和編程語言是非常重要的。只有建立在堅實的基礎之上,云服務器掛機程序才能穩定、高效地運行,并發揮最大的潛力。希望本文對讀者在了解云服務器掛機程序的基礎方面提供了一些啟示和幫助。
以上就是小編關于“云服務器掛機程序需要什么基礎”的分享和介紹
三五互聯(35.com)是經工信部審批,持有ISP、云牌照、IDC、CDN全業務資質的正規老牌云服務商,自成立至今20余年專注于域名注冊、虛擬主機、云服務器、企業郵箱、企業建站等互聯網基礎服務!
公司自研的云計算平臺,以便捷高效、超高性價比、超預期售后等優勢占領市場,穩居中國接入服務商排名前三,為中國超過50萬網站提供了高速、穩定的托管服務!先后獲評中國高新技術企業、中國優秀云計算服務商、全國十佳IDC企業、中國最受歡迎的云服務商等稱號!
目前,三五互聯高性能云服務器正在進行特價促銷,最低僅需48元!
http://www.shinetop.cn/cloudhost/